Hello everyone,

I got my 2004 GX over the weekend. One of the first thing I noticed was that the driver side window does not continously roll down or up when I push the button. Once I take my finger off the button, the window stops rolling.

Other windows appear to roll up or down fine with one firm push of the button.

When driving at night, I've also noticed that the light on the window button blinks intermittently and others are not having this behavior.

Anyone encounter this before or may know a fix?

I think there is a section in the manual about reprogramming a window switch. Apparently, this happens when the power is removed from the battery. But, in your case I am curious if the setting is just goofed up, and needs to be reprogrammed. There is a procedure for teaching the window the roll-up height and tension. Again, not sure if that is what the problem is, but worth looking into the manual for it. :)
